About Chitester
The surname Chitester is of English origin and is believed to be derived from the Old English word "cyst," meaning "chest" or "box," and the occupational suffix "-er," denoting a person who works with or makes something. Therefore, the surname Chitester likely originated as an occupational name for someone who made or repaired chests or boxes.
